Specifications

  • Item ConditionNew
  • Bezel Material stainless steel, titanium or Diamond-like Carbon (DLC) coated steel
  • Case Material Fiber-reinforced polymer with metal rear cover
  • Color Display Yes
  • Display Resolution 260 x 260 pixels
  • Display Size1.3” diameter
  • Display Type Sunlight-visible, transflective memory-in-pixel (MIP)
  • Internal Memory/History 32 GB
  • Lens MaterialCorning Gorilla Glass DX or Sapphire Crystal
  • QuickFit Watch Band Compatible Yes - 22mm
  • Water Proof Rating 10 ATM
  • Battery Life:Smartwatch: Up to 14 days
    Battery Saver Watch Mode: Up to 48 days
    GPS: Up to 36 hours
    GPS + Music: Up to 10 hours
    Max Battery GPS Mode: Up to 72 hours
    Expedition GPS Activity: Up to 28 days

Description

The fenix 6 Smartwatch by Garmin was specifically designed for individuals with extreme outdoor lifestyles, and comes preloaded with a wide array specially designed apps and features to give you an extra edge in the field. One of its more notable features is its multi-GNSS support capabilities, which provides access to GPS, GLONASS, and Galileo global navigation satellite systems for greater navigational accuracy than GPS alone. Other navigational features include Round-Trip Routing, which allows you to enter a distance you want to travel and get suggested routes which will bring you back to your starting point. This smartwatch also utilizes Trendline – a feature that incorporates billions of Garmin Connect data collected from other Garmin users to help you find and follow the best trails and routes. The Turn-By-Turn Navigation feature is included to help you stay on course with turn by turn directions which let you know ahead of time when the next turn is coming. The fenix 6 also features ABC sensors including an altimeter, barometer, and 3-axis digital compass, and Expedition Mode – an ultra-low powered GPS reference that extends battery life to weeks.

In addition to its advanced satellite tracking abilities, the fenix 6 is equipped with several sensors to monitor your body’s performance. This includes a wrist-based heart rate monitor which gauges activity intensity as well as heart rate variability to calculate your stress level and even tracks underwater without a heart rate strap. The respiration tracking app is included to keep track of your breathing throughout the day, during sleep and during breath-work activities, and a pulse OX sensor which uses light beams at your wrist to gauge how well your body is absorbing oxygen. Other body monitoring apps include the Body Battery which optimizes your body’s energy reserves by tracking heart rate variability, stress, sleep and other data to gauge when you’re ready to be active or when you may need to rest, and hydration tracking which monitors your estimated sweat loss after an activity and gives you reminders to stay hydrated.
